7 Creative Ways to Use Leftover Ingredients

7 Creative Ways to Use Leftover Ingredients

We’ve all been there – staring into the depths of our refrigerator, wondering what to do with that handful of herbs or half a carton of sour cream that’s about to go bad. Instead of letting these ingredients go to waste, why not get a little creative with your cooking and come up with some delicious and inventive ways to use them up? Here are 7 creative ways to make the most of your leftover ingredients:

1. Herb-infused oils and vinegars

If you have a bunch of fresh herbs that are on their last legs, don’t throw them out just yet. Instead, turn them into herb-infused oils and vinegars that can add a burst of flavor to your dishes. Simply chop up the herbs and place them in a jar with your choice of oil or vinegar. Let the flavors infuse for a few days before straining out the herbs and using the infused oil or vinegar in dressings, marinades, or drizzled over roasted vegetables.

2. Homemade stocks and broths

Leftover vegetables like carrots, celery, and onions can easily be transformed into a delicious homemade stock or broth. Simply simmer the vegetables in water with some herbs and seasoning for a few hours to extract all the flavor. You can then use the stock as a base for soups, stews, and risottos, or freeze it in ice cube trays for easy use in future recipes.

3. Fruit compotes and jams

If you have a surplus of ripe fruit that’s starting to soften, why not turn it into a tasty fruit compote or jam? Simply cook the fruit with a bit of sugar and lemon juice until it breaks down into a thick, chunky sauce. You can use the compote as a topping for pancakes, yogurt, or ice cream, or spread the jam on toast or sandwiches for a sweet treat.

4. Frittatas and quiches

Leftover vegetables, meats, and cheeses can all find a home in a frittata or quiche. Simply whisk together some eggs with a bit of milk or cream, then add in your leftover ingredients and pour everything into a greased baking dish. Bake until the eggs are set and the top is golden brown for a quick and easy meal that’s perfect for breakfast, brunch, or dinner.

5. Homemade pesto

If you have a surplus of fresh herbs, nuts, or cheese, why not make your own homemade pesto? Simply blend the ingredients together with some olive oil, garlic, and lemon juice until you have a smooth, flavorful sauce. You can use the pesto as a topping for pasta, grilled meats, or roasted vegetables, or spread it on sandwiches or wraps for a burst of flavor.

6. Pickled vegetables

If you have an abundance of vegetables that are starting to wilt, pickling is a great way to preserve them and add a tangy crunch to your dishes. Simply pack the vegetables into a jar with some vinegar, sugar, and spices, then store in the refrigerator for a few days to let the flavors develop. You can use pickled vegetables in salads, sandwiches, or as a side dish for meats and cheeses.

7. Bread pudding

Leftover bread, whether it’s stale baguette, rolls, or croissants, can easily be transformed into a delicious bread pudding. Simply tear the bread into bite-sized pieces and place in a greased baking dish. Whisk together some eggs, milk, sugar, and spices, then pour the mixture over the bread. Bake until the pudding is set and golden brown for a comforting dessert that’s perfect for using up leftover bread.
